Here's how I really hope they do mutants:
Say some mutants were always there (Apocalypse, Magneto, Mystique, Xavier, Wolverine, Sabretooth) because the mutant gene exists.
Say the energy from the Snap woke up a bunch of X-genes. Mutants have been popping up and Xavier, Magneto, and Apocalypse have all been gathering them for their own ends behind the scenes. So at 5-6 years later all the new mutants have received some level of training.
The second snap that brought people back also woke up a lot of X-genes both in the survivors and the returned, so now there will be too many mutants to keep hidden.
At least that's how I would do it.
